Playmini or Milltek

Right I've had my R50 a few months now and it's time to start with the modifications!! I'm a couple of weeks from affording a Bluefin which I'm deffo getting, now it's the exhaust. I've seen a couple of videos on Youtube, one was MiniPetrolHead's nice sounding Milltek, and the other was of some guys Playmini. I really like the sound of the Playmini and I think it's fairly cheap too, the cheapest I've seen the Milltek catback is £395, whereas the Playmini just over £200.

Anyone got these on their One's or advice for which one to get? Any vids would be nice too

Quote: Originally Posted by MiniOneSam (original)
Both sound really good. Jonmorgan did you say that the Larini does not affect your Mini warranty? I take it the Milltek does!! Does anyone have videos of these? (Seen yours already MiniPetrolHead!! )

they both have the same effect on warranty as each other, the part you fit will not be covered, and if something ever did go wrong which could be blamed on that part then you wouldn't be covered. But changing an exhaust hasn't ever caused an engine to blow as far as I am aware, so get it done
